Danville man killed in crash between SUV and 'motorized bicycle'

DANVILLE, Ill. (WCIA) — One person is dead following a crash in Danville between a “motorized bicycle” and an SUV on Sunday, police said.

The crash happened around 4:11 p.m. in the area of Harmon and Voorhees Streets. Joshua Webb, Danville’s Deputy Chief of Police, said a 43-year-old man was severely injured in the crash, and he was later pronounced dead at OSF Sacred Heart Medical Center.

A preliminary investigation was performed by the Danville Police Department, with assistance from the Illinois State Police Accident Reconstruction Team.

Webb said the investigation determined the victim was riding the motorized bike, traveling north on Harmon Street, when he failed to yield at the stop sign. The SUV was driving east on Voorhees, and the bike hit its passenger-side door.

The driver of the SUV was not hurt.

Webb stated that the victim was a 43-year-old man from Danville, but provided no further information about him. The Vermilion County Coroner’s Office will release his name once his family is notified.

The investigation into the crash is ongoing, Webb added. Anyone with further information on the crash is advised to call the Danville Police Department at 217-431-2250.
